#647d4b h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#647d4b is composed of 39.2% red, 49%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20% cyan, 0% magenta, 40%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 90 degrees, a saturation of 25% and a lightness of 39.2%. #647d4b color hex could be obtained by blending #c8fa96 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#647d4b color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.
The hexadecimal color #647d4b has RGB values of R:100, G:125,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 6585675.
